Merge master.kernel.org:/pub/scm/linux/kernel/git/mchehab/v4l-dvb
* master.kernel.org:/pub/scm/linux/kernel/git/mchehab/v4l-dvb: V4L/DVB (4290): Add support for the TCL M2523_3DB_E tuner. V4L/DVB (4289): Missing statement in drivers/media/dvb/frontends/cx22700.c V4L/DVB (4288): Clean out a zillion sparse warnings in pvrusb2 V4L/DVB (4287): Pvrusb2/: possible cleanups V4L/DVB (4285): Cx88: add support for Geniatech Digistar / Digiwave 103g V4L/DVB (4284): Cx24123: fix set_voltage function according to the specs V4L/DVB (4282): Fix: use swzigzag for swalgo V4L/DVB (4281): TDA9887_SET_CONFIG should only be handled by the tda9887. V4L/DVB (4277): Fix CI interface on PRO KNC1 cards V4L/DVB (4276): Fix CI on old KNC1 DVBC cards V4L/DVB (4275): The FE_SET_FRONTEND_TUNE_MODE ioctl always returns EOPNOTSUPP V4L/DVB (4274): Eliminate use of tda9887 from pvrusb2 driver V4L/DVB (4273): Always log pvrusb2 device register / unregister events V4L/DVB (4272): Fix tveeprom supported standards V4L/DVB (4270): Add tda9887-specific tuner configuration V4L/DVB (4269): Subject: videocodec: make 1-bit fields unsigned V4L/DVB (4267): Remove all instances of request_module("tda9887") V4L/DVB (4264): Cx88-blackbird: implement VIDIOC_QUERYCTRL and VIDIOC_QUERYMENU
